Mobile Gaming Portal Joyme Wins Series C from Youku Tudou, Ourpalm
36Kr.com, 8/03/15
Beijing-based online entertainment company Lexiang Fangdeng (EnjoyFound), operator of mobile gaming web portal Joyme.com, has completed Series C funding from Chinese online video site operator Youku Tudou (NYSE: YOKU) and Beijing-based mobile game developer Ourpalm (300315.SZ). The company is reportedly planning a listing on China's OTC-style agency share transfer system, the National Equities Exchange and Quotations (NEEQ), at the end of the year, and is currently working with brokers to complete the preliminary steps.
In addition to the investment, Youku Tudou will establish an all-new Joyme operated gaming center on its platform expected to launch in mid-August. Joyme and Youku Tudou will also form a joint venture to publish games under an independent brand name, where Joyme will have greater access to Youku Tudou's IP resources, and Youku Tudou will be able to more fully utilize its IP resources (i.e. will be able to generate additional value from adaptation of its IP into video games).
Joyme currently has approximately 10 mln monthly active users.
